Main camera not rendering in GearVR
I'm working on a space game and have 3 cameras in my scene, MainCamera (the nearest) for showing just the interior of the ship and the ui, Camera_LocalSpace for showing objects in space that are scaled up (I'm using a fixed origin, moving the universe around the ship, and scaling in size objects as I approach/move away from them), and Camera_ScaledSpace to show objects which are far away and remain scaled down. The settings for all 3 cameras can be seen in the image.
When running the game within Unity, everything is fine. The problem is, MainCamera doesn't render anything when I make a build and run it in GearVR (Camera_LocalSpace and Camera_ScaledSpace both render perfectly). I've verified the settings stay the same when the game runs within Unity. I've tried adjusting the camera sizes and clipping plane distances. I've triple-checked the culling masks. I've made a build with only MainCamera (with a star background for a Skybox) but the result is an empty gray universe, the same color as the "Made With Unity" screen. I've put Camera_LocalSpace and Camera_ScaledSpace on the Default layer and the layers you see in the image, but no change.
I'm using Unity 2018.1.2f1 Personal (64 bit) on Windows 10, and building to Android. I updated to the latest Android sdk a week or so ago.
Has anyone else encountered the same problem? I've searching the forum and Google and found some suggestions but nothing seems to work. Prior to updating the Android sdk I was only using MainCamera and everything was fine, so I'm not sure if the issue is with the latest Android, or with some setting which I'm overlooking.
